If your goal is to have a small carbon footprint on the world, this junior studio fits the bill! Available for immediate move-in, this studio apartment has everything you need to make this home. Hardwood floors, two bright windows, nice closet for storage, efficient kitchen area oven, fridge, microwave, lots of cabinets and granite countertop as well as a bright, large bathroom. The dimension are: Entry foyer – 7.75' x 2.5' Main room – 14' x 9.88' wide (the long wall is 14' and the short wall is 9.75') Bathroom – 6' deep x 5' wide The location is fantastic. You're right on the corner of 34th Street and First Avenue in Kips Bay. You're within walking distance of Starbucks, Fairway, Trader Joe's, Crunch Gym, NYSC and Grand Central Station. The crosstown M34 and M34A buses will get you quickly to the West side (Penn Station), the East River Ferry is one block away, the 4 and 6 trains are on Park and 33rd, FDR Drive and so much more. You can drop your laundry off around the corner and have it washed, dried and folded with same day service for just $1/pound. Otherwise, there's a laundromat on 33rd and 3rd Ave. NYU Langone is on First Avenue and the United Nations is straight up First Avenue. Landlord is looking for income of 40x the rent or better ($67,000) and guarantors are accepted, too ($134,000). Great credit (700 or better) is needed as well. Sorry, no pets.
